When you're deep in an AI session—generating content, having a compelling conversation, or exploring ideas—meals become an interruption. Some AI-dependent users regularly skip meals, losing track of time as hours pass without eating. Others eat mindlessly while using AI, grabbing whatever is convenient without paying attention to nutrition. Either pattern, sustained over time, takes a toll on health.

How AI Disrupts Eating Patterns

AI dependency can affect nutrition in several ways: time displacement (AI sessions replace meal preparation and cooking), disrupted hunger cues (intense focus suppresses awareness of hunger), convenience defaulting (choosing fast food or snacks to minimize interruption of AI use), and eating while distracted (consuming food during AI sessions without awareness of quantity or quality).

Warning Signs

  • Regularly skipping meals because you're engaged with AI
  • Eating primarily convenience or delivery food to stay near devices
  • Not noticing hunger until it becomes extreme
  • Weight changes—either loss from skipped meals or gain from mindless snacking
  • Declining interest in cooking or shared meals

Restoring Healthy Eating

  • Set meal times as AI-free intervals
  • Eat meals away from screens
  • Prepare food as a mindful activity that counters AI immersion
  • Share meals with others—eating is inherently social
  • Pay attention to how nutrition affects your energy and mood
